Why These Are the Top BMW Repair Auto Repair Shops in Eaton

The BMW repair market for Eaton, CO residents is characterized by a reliance on service providers in the surrounding Northern Colorado metro areas, primarily Fort Collins and Greeley. There are no dedicated BMW-only specialists physically located within Eaton's city limits. The market is moderately competitive among the high-quality independents in the region, which drives a high standard of service. These shops compete directly with the BMW of Loveland dealership by offering comparable expertise at a lower labor rate, typically 20-30% less. Pricing for standard maintenance is competitive, while specialized work on xDrive, performance tuning, and complex engine diagnostics commands a premium but remains more cost-effective than the dealer. The overall quality of available service is high, with several shops employing former dealership master technicians.

What are the most common BMW repair issues you see in Eaton, Colorado, due to our local climate and roads?

Given Eaton's cold winters and rural roads, we frequently address issues like early battery failure due to temperature extremes, suspension component wear from rough or uneven surfaces, and cooling system vulnerabilities. These conditions can accelerate wear on specific BMW components compared to milder urban environments.

How can I find a reputable BMW-specific repair shop in the Eaton or Northern Colorado area?

Look for a shop with BMW-specific diagnostic tools and certified technicians, as general mechanics often lack the required specialization. In Northern Colorado, seek shops that are members of the BMW Car Club of America (Rocky Mountain Chapter) or have strong local reviews highlighting their BMW expertise and transparency.

When should I seek local service versus going to a Denver-area BMW dealership?

For most routine maintenance, diagnostics, and common repairs, a qualified local Eaton shop can provide faster, often more cost-effective service. For highly complex warranty work, specific recall campaigns, or proprietary software programming that requires a direct manufacturer connection, a dealership may be necessary.

Are BMW repair costs in Eaton typically higher than for other car brands?

Yes, BMW repair and maintenance costs are generally higher due to specialized parts, advanced technology, and the technical expertise required. However, using a trusted independent specialist in Eaton can offer significant savings over dealership prices while maintaining the quality of OEM or equivalent parts.

What local considerations should I have for my BMW's maintenance schedule in this area?

Eaton's climate necessitates more frequent attention to your battery, t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S), and all-season or winter tire condition. We also recommend more frequent cabin air filter changes during high pollen seasons and after harvest times due to regional agricultural dust.
